| 2 | | WHEREAS, The members of the Illinois Senate are saddened to | 3 | | learn of the death of Rose (Daydif) Eaton of Waukegan, who | 4 | | passed away on July 19, 2019; and
| 5 | | WHEREAS, Rose Eaton was born to Chris and Zaka Daydif on | 6 | | October 10, 1922; she lived in Waukegan her entire life; as a | 7 | | young woman, she was a hostess with the USO, ultimately | 8 | | becoming the president of the local chapter; she spent many | 9 | | hours at the USO at the Waukegan Armory dancing with servicemen | 10 | | and, when asked, writing letters to their family and friends; | 11 | | in 1945, she was nominated for a prestigious award from the USO | 12 | | and was ultimately one of ten national finalists; she married | 13 | | Homer "Buck" Eaton on July 17, 1948; and
| 14 | | WHEREAS, Rose Eaton began working in the Personnel | 15 | | Department at Abbott Laboratories after graduating high | 16 | | school; later, she worked at the Great Lakes Naval Base in the | 17 | | chaplain's department, where she supported priests, rabbis, | 18 | | and ministers who counseled the young servicemen; she was | 19 | | ultimately transferred to the Chapel by the Lake and retired | 20 | | from that position in 1984; and
| 21 | | WHEREAS, After retirement, Rose Eaton was a volunteer at | 22 | | the Waukegan Public Library and worked at the Reference Desk, |

| 1 | | where she assisted patrons at the library and handled telephone | 2 | | requests; she also worked in the accessory department at Carson | 3 | | Pirie Scott, which fulfilled her creative interests; she was a | 4 | | member of Grace Missionary Church in Zion; she had many talents | 5 | | and excelled as a seamstress; she loved to cook and to collect | 6 | | recipes; and
| 7 | | WHEREAS, Rose Eaton was preceded in death by her husband of | 8 | | 61 years, Buck; her parents; and her brothers, Michael Daydif | 9 | | Sr. and Karl Daydif; and
| 10 | | WHEREAS, Rose Eaton is survived by her daughters, Janis | 11 | | Eaton and Debra Eaton; her nephews, Michael (Cathy) Daydif and | 12 | | Bruce (Susan) Daydif; and her nieces, Karen Shuler and Sue | 13 | | Harvey; therefore, be it
| 14 | | RESOLVED, BY THE SENATE OF THE ONE HUNDRED FIRST GENERAL | 15 | | ASSEMBLY OF THE STATE OF ILLINOIS, that we mourn the passing of | 16 | | Rose (Daydif) Eaton and extend our sincere condolences to her | 17 | | family, friends, and all who knew and loved her; and be it | 18 | | further
| 19 | | RESOLVED, That a suitable copy of this resolution be | 20 | | presented to the family of Rose Eaton as an expression of our | 21 | | deepest sympathy.
